Understanding the RTX 5060 Ti Undervolt

Undervolting involves reducing the voltage supplied to the GPU while maintaining stable performance. This process helps decrease heat output and power consumption, enabling better thermal management and potentially higher overclocking headroom.

Cooling Mods for Enhanced Thermal Performance

Upgrading the Stock Cooler

Replacing the stock cooler with a high-quality aftermarket air cooler or a custom water cooling loop can dramatically lower GPU temperatures. Look for coolers with larger heatsinks and better thermal paste application for optimal results.

Adding Additional Fans

Improving airflow within your PC case is vital. Install additional case fans with high static pressure ratings to direct cool air towards the GPU and exhaust hot air efficiently. Consider fan placement to create a positive pressure environment.

Using Thermal Pads and Paste

Upgrading thermal pads on VRAM and VRMs can help transfer heat more effectively. Reapplying high-quality thermal paste between the GPU die and heatsink reduces thermal resistance and improves cooling performance.

Overclocking Tips for the RTX 5060 Ti

Start with Slight Increases

Gradually increase the core clock and memory clock in small steps. Use tools like MSI Afterburner to monitor stability and temperatures during each adjustment.

Adjust Power Limits and Voltage

Increase the power limit to allow higher clock speeds. Undervolt the GPU slightly to maintain lower temperatures while pushing performance, balancing voltage and stability carefully.

Stress Test and Monitor

Use stress testing tools like FurMark or Unigine Heaven to verify stability after each overclock. Keep an eye on temperatures and frame rates to ensure optimal performance without overheating.

Additional Tips for Optimal Performance

  • Maintain good airflow in your case with clean filters and unobstructed vents.
  • Regularly update GPU drivers for improved stability and performance.
  • Monitor GPU temperatures and performance metrics regularly using software like HWMonitor or GPU-Z.
  • Use fan curves to optimize cooling based on temperature thresholds.
